Patients with metastatic non-small-cell lung cancer (NSCLC) who survive more than 2 years are considered long-term survivors (LTSs). The present study examined factors associated with long-term ...survival and collected information for future comparison.
Clinical, molecular, and therapeutic data were collected from patients followed for primary stage IV (7th TNM classification) NSCLC within 2 years from diagnosis in the respiratory medicine departments of 53 French non-teaching hospitals. LTS and non-LTS records were compared. Factors associated with long-term survival were examined by univariate and multivariate analyses using logistic regression models.
Vital status at least 2 years after diagnosis was known for 1977 stage IV NSCLC patients; 220 (11.1%) were LTSs. On multivariate analysis, independent positive factors comprised: TTF-1(+) immunochemistry, EGFR-mutation, surgery, rescue radiotherapy, and targeted therapy. Independent negative factors comprised: prediagnosis weight loss>5kg, ECOG performance status>1, and primary radiotherapy.
Molecular biology and targeted therapy were decisive for long-term survival. With their development and their widespread implementation in clinical practice, the percentage of LTSs is expected to grow. Factors determining long-term survival found in this study should be taken into account when considering treatment options for patients with stage IV NSCLC.

A good agreement is obtained between calculations of permeability and thermal conductivity of foams characterized by microtomography and measurements.
Three dimensional samples of three different ...foams are obtained by microtomography. The macroscopic conductivity and permeability of these foams are calculated by three different numerical techniques based on either a finite volume discretization or Lattice Boltzmann algorithm. Permeability is also measured and an excellent agreement is obtained between the various estimations. Calculated conductivities are successfully compared to available data.

Infliximab (Remicade) is an anti-TNF alpha indicated in the treatment of chronic inflammatory rheumatism, notably rheumatoid arthritis.
We report the case of a 56 year-old woman who developed severe ...worsening of an SSA-positive subacute lupus erythematosus on initiation of treatment with infliximab for rheumatoid arthritis.
A review of the literature found 30 cases of drug-induced lupus and listed the autoimmune modifications induced by anti-TNF alpha. This first case of subacute lupus erythematosus, existing before the introduction of treatment and worsening during the latter, emphasizes the risk of developing a severe flare of an autoimmune disease during treatment with anti-TNF alpha. It raises the question of the relative contraindications of anti-TNF alpha in patients with lupus erythematosus.

The production of ganciclovir doses by a hospital pharmacy having the necessary facilities to reconstitute anticancer drugs would be of the utmost relevance regarding both protection of the nursing ...staff and therapeutic safety. As this activity is also economically worthwhile a large number of our colleagues would like to implement it. The aim of this work has was to take advantage of a 40 weeks production of ganciclovir dose by the pharmacy at Rangueil hospital in Toulouse so as to answer some of the questions raised by such a project. The savings achieved by the team at Brabois hospital in Vandoeuvre les Nancy could therefore be validated. They are expressed in fraction of flask per dose produced (0,265). Applied to the number of doses that we delivered over a 40 week period, this coefficient enabled us to estimate from the only datum which is initially available to us, namely the number of flasks used, the extra work load and the savings that could be made: given steady activity, the number of doses the pharmacy will have to prepare is equal to the number of flasks multiplied by 1.418 and, provided one opts for a production process mostly in batches, the savings will be equivalent to 37.5% of the flasks.
All-Niobium Nitride Josephson junctions have been prepared successfully using a new processing called SNOP : Selective Niobium (Nitride) Overlap Process. Such a process involves the "trilayer" ...deposition on the whole wafer before selective patterning of the electrodes by optically controlled Dry Reactive Ion Etching. Only two photomask levels are need to define an "overlap" or a "cross-type" junction with a good accuracy. The properties of the Niobium Nitride films deposited by DC-Magnetron sputtering and the surface oxide growth are analysed. The most critical point to obtain high quality and high gap value junctions resides in the early stage of the NbN counterelectrode growth. Some possibilities to overcome such a handicap exist even if the fabrication needs substrate temperatures below 250 °C.
Process test chips for Josephson integrated Circuits including refractory metal resistors have been achieved and tested with Niobium based technology made in LETI. Tantalum resistors are lying above ...niobium base electrode. Such a configuration gives compact logic circuits and very good mechanical bahaviours. An entire 14 layers technology including Nb-Nb 2 O 5 - Pb(In) tunnel junctions, control lines and contact pads is being achieved and described. Arrays of 100 interferometers cells, superconductive contacts in series, and other chips for measuring capacitance of junctions and insulators, penetration depths in superconductive materials, resistors are fabricated on sapphire, wafers and tested. Such devices yield a good stability upon thermal cycling and storage at room temperature.
